import itertools import shutil import tempfile from glob import glob from twisted.internet.utils import getProcessOutputAndValue class InvalidGPGSignature(Exception): """Raised when the gpg signature for a given file is invalid.""" def gpg_verify(filename, signature, gpg="/usr/bin/gpg", apt_dir="/etc/apt"): """Verify the GPG signature of a file. @param filename: Path to the file to verify the signature against. @param signature: Path to signature to use. @param gpg: Optionally, path to the GPG binary to use. @param apt_dir: Optionally, path to apt trusted keyring. @return: a C{Deferred} resulting in C{True} if the signature is valid, C{False} otherwise. """ def remove_gpg_home(ignored): shutil.rmtree(gpg_home) return ignored def check_gpg_exit_code(args): out, err, code = args # We want a nice error message with Python 3 as well, so decode the # bytes here. out, err = out.decode("ascii"), err.decode("ascii") if code != 0: raise InvalidGPGSignature( f"{gpg} failed (out='{out}', err='{err}', code='{code:d}')", ) gpg_home = tempfile.mkdtemp() keyrings = tuple( itertools.chain( *[ ("--keyring", keyring) for keyring in sorted( glob(f"{apt_dir}/trusted.gpg") + glob(f"{apt_dir}/trusted.gpg.d/*.gpg"), ) ], ), ) args = ( ( "--no-options", "--homedir", gpg_home, "--no-default-keyring", "--ignore-time-conflict", ) + keyrings + ("--verify", signature, filename) ) result = getProcessOutputAndValue(gpg, args=args) result.addBoth(remove_gpg_home) result.addCallback(check_gpg_exit_code) return result
